AP63203 EVB User Guide

1. General Description

The AP63203 is a 2A, synchronous buck converter with up to 32V wide input voltage range, which fully
integrates a 140mΩ high-side MOSFET and a 70mΩ low-side MOSFET to provide high efficiency
step-down DC/DC conversion. The AP63203 adopts peak current mode control with the integrated
compensation network, which makes AP63203 easily to be used by minimizing the off-chip component
count. The AP63203 supports the Pulse Skipping Modulation (PSM) with typical 22uA Ultra-low
Quiescent and achieved high efficient performance at light load conditions.
The AP63203 is fixed output buck converters with optimized design for Electromagnetic Interference
(EMI) reduction. The AP63203 features Frequency Spread Spectrum (FSS) with ± 6% jittering span of the
1.1MHz switching frequency and modulation rate 1/512 of switching frequency to reduce the conducted
EMI. The converter has proprietary designed gate driver scheme to resist switching node ringing without
sacrificing MOSFET turn on and turn off time, which further erases high frequency radiation EMI noise
caused by the MOSFETs hard switching.
The AP63203 offers output overvoltage protection, cycle-by-cycle peak current limit, and thermal
shutdown protection. The device is available in a low-profile TSOT23-6 package.

2. Key Features

EMI Reduction with Switching Node Ringing-free
3.8V-32V Wide Input Voltage Range
Up to 2A Continuous Output Load Current
Shutdown Current: <1µ A
1.1Mitching Frequency with 6% Frequency Spread Spectrum (FSS)
Precision Enable Threshold for Programmable UVLO Threshold and Hysteresis
Low Dropout Mode Operation
No External Compensation Required
Current Limit Protection
Short Circuit Protection
Over Output Voltage Protection
Thermal Shutdown
